A: There isn't a strict age limit for the scavenger hunt, but it's designed for older kids and adults. I'd say ages 10 and up would really enjoy it, especially since some clues can be a bit tricky. Just keep in mind that younger kids might need a bit of help with the puzzles!
A: The best time is definitely spring or fall. The weather in Dallas can be pretty hot in summer, so you might want to avoid July and August. Plus, spring and fall have beautiful scenery and outdoor events, making it even more fun!
A: You can definitely do this scavenger hunt without a car! The tour covers a lot of downtown areas where public transport is available. Just check your route ahead of time. Parking might be a challenge if you decide to drive, so public transport might be the way to go.
